Rogue Planet Challenges Star-Planet Formation Boundaries

Story summary
  • Cha 1107-7626, a rogue planet 620 light-years away, accretes at six billion tonnes per second.
  • The study, led by Víctor Almendros-Abad, used ESO's Very Large Telescope and the James Webb Space Telescope.
  • Findings suggest rogue planets may form like stars, blurring the boundary between planetary-mass objects and stars.
  • Magnetic activity drives mass infall, a mechanism previously seen only in stars.
